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Superbutt's song Last Call evoke the sense of an emotional battle that is taking place inside the mind of the singer. The singer is torn between wanting to let go of their pain and wanting to hold onto it to use it to their advantage. The line "I push myself up against the wall, and I put my hands where I can see them" is a metaphor for the singer's attempt to hold themselves accountable for their actions and not let their pain control them. The line "up to my neck I stand there for you all" suggests a sense of vulnerability and exposure to the world, while the line "let anyone roll, let anyone, come have a bite, share a cup" portrays the singer as welcoming others to join them in their emotional turmoil.


The second verse of the song further reinforces the idea of the singer using their pain to their advantage. The line "I laugh at my wounds and I use them against you all" shows that the singer has come to terms with their pain and is no longer afraid of it. The line "I’d do anything to be you right now, and I know I could hurt myself so much more" suggests that the singer is dealing with some kind of inner turmoil and wishes they could swap places with someone else. The final lines of the song "Last call, I’m bleeding everywhere, Last call, I take it, I’d do anything to save myself right now, Cos I know I’d be so much more, Last call, I’m bleeding everywhere, ever I’m taking that fall" suggest that the singer is willing to endure their pain and take the fall it brings with it.
